By the end of the Constant Velocity unit students are able to accurately describe the motion of objects with constant velocity represent it through multiple representations and predict the motion of objects with constant motion beyond the time they have observed the motion Object moves with constant positive velocity for 4 seconds Then it stops for 2 seconds
